So this started out as a can of Baked Beans, very delicious on a slice of toast.
I used sticky-back canvas to cover the tin, which had been stamped up using a variety of   Stampers Anonymous and Chocholate Baroque stamps. The trimmings are from my stash.
It is a realy useful container for my scraps of ribbon, lace and petals. Did you notice my title,  'desk tidy', it does help to have an aim, but my desk is always work in progress. I can never find a thing after a tidy-up session.

Remembrance




Sharing a digital picture with you today.  I  had all the images from a M.C.S. disc.

It is my  way to thank  all those brave men and women all over our world, who give their lives, so we can live in 'Peace'.
In the U.K. Poppies are worn in Remembrance. Where there is a ' two minute  period of silence',   held as a mark of respect  on the 11th hour, of the 11th day, of the 11th month.    Today.
